MOORLAND Fuels in Okehampton has announced that eight-year-old Teddie Kronsnabl, from Sticklepath, has won the competition to design the fuel company’s Christmas card.
The card will be sent to Moorland Fuels’ gold service customers and handed out by drivers throughout the month of December.
This is the fifth year that the company has run its Christmas Card Contest, and this year more than 250 children from several different schools throughout the area participated.
Ben More, Moorland Fuels managing director, said: ‘We really look forward to this competition every year!
‘Teddie’s card really stood out to us because of its bright colours, attention to details and its wintry feel. We especially liked the reindeer on the tanker and the cheerful robin perched on a tree stump.’
Teddie said that she entered the competition because she loves drawing and would like to be an artist when she is older.
The young art-ethusiast has won a family day out at Crealy Advernture Park and Moorland Fuels has donated £50 to her chosen charity South Tawton Parent Teacher Association (PTA).
Teddie chose South Tawton PTA because she wanted to support her school and their fundraising activities.
